Cost of Goods Sold
The costs incurred directly from manufacturing the goods a company sells.
Overapplied
A situation where the allocated overhead costs in accounting exceed the actual overhead costs incurred.
Underapplied
In cost accounting, it describes a situation where the allocated overhead costs are less than the actual overhead costs incurred.
Manufacturing Overhead
All the extra expenses tied to production except for direct materials and workforce costs.
